IPS schools have increased their graduation rate by about 17%! Unfortunately it seems that they haven’t done this by providing better education, they have accomplished this by providing waivers to students so that they can graduate. 26.7% of IPS students last year graduated with a diploma using a waiver.
In case your wondering in order for a student to graduate - among other factors, it requires the student to pass Algebra I (generally taken in 9th grade) and 10th grade English.
“To earn a waiver, seniors who have not passed one of the required tests must show they had 95% attendance and had a C average in that subject. If they took the test every time it was offered, completed extra help sessions offered at school and earned a recommendation from a teacher and the principal they can still graduate.” - Scott Elliott
To put this in perspective, statewide 21.41% of black students graduated with a waiver compared to 14.12% of hispanic students, and 5.7% of white students.
